- Title
Initiating Insulin Detemir Improves Glycemic Control Without Weight Gain in OAD-Treated Insulin-Naive Patients with Type 2 Diabetes: 6-Month Results from PREDICTIVE™.
- Authors
Trippe, Bruce; Honka, Marek; Kozlovski, Plamen; Dornhorst, Anne
- Abstract
The article focuses on a study that was conducted to evaluate the effectiveness of initiating insulin detemir to improve glycemic control without weight gain in OAD-treated insulin-naive patients with type 2 diabetes. Insulin detemir resulted in improvements in glycemic control and a decrease in body weight. The study found that in insulin-naive type 2 diabetes patients, the initiation of insulin detemir therapy was associated with improvements in glycemic control without weight gain.
